Spiced Lamb Cutlets with Garlicky Yoghurt
Preparation time is 5minutes
Cook time is 10minutes
Total time is 15minutes
Serve is for 12 people
Difficulty level: 3 out of 4

10 Ingredients

Number of servings
12
  • 2tablespoons coriander leaves, chopped, plus extra leaves (to garnish)
  • 1tablespoons ginger, grated
  • 12 lamb cutlets
  • 1teaspoons ground coriander
  • 2teaspoons ground turmeric
  • 1 lemon, juiced (plus lemon wedges, to serve)
  • 200grams Greek-style yoghurt
  • 1t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 long green chilli, deseeded, finely ch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, crushed

Nutrition per serving

1170 Kilojoules or 279 Calories
13% of daily energy intake*
Protein
20.5grams
Fat
21.2grams
Carbs
1.6grams
Sugars
1.0grams

Quantities above are a guide only. *Percentage daily energy intake is based on an average adult diet of 8700 kJ.

Method

Step 1 of 3

Combine ginger, turmeric, coriander, chilli, juice and oil in a bowl. Lay cutlets in a baking tray and brush both sides with spice paste. Set aside for 15 minutes to marinate. Preheat a chargrill pan on high heat.

Step 2 of 3

Meanwhile, combine yoghurt, garlic and chopped coriander. Season to taste. Grill cutlets for 3-4 minutes each side or until cooked to your liking.

Step 3 of 3

Pile cutlets onto a serving platter and scatter with coriander leaves. Serve with garlicky yoghurt and lemon wedges.
